PreS-K—Arthur is a young mouse who loves to wear his dragon costume and play with his mother. The day comes, though, when she needs to go out, and he must spend the day with his grandmother. At first Arthur resists, but eventually his mother gets him settled in, and his grandmother takes over coddling and distracting him with painting and music and even a treasure trove to keep him from being grumpy. Each time the doorbell rings, though, the youngster is disappointed to find that it is not his mother. Just as he has found the activity that is the most distracting, playing knights and dragons in the garden, she returns and greets him with a big hug. Edgson's soft acrylic illustrations are adorable, and each member of the mouse family is more wide-eyed and snuggly than the last.—
